In Changsha, China, May unveils a warm and humid atmosphere, with maximum temperatures soaring to 35°C (96°F), while the average temperature hovers at a comfortable 22°C (71°F). This month is characterized by an occasional respite from the heat, as temperatures can dip to a minimum of 12°C (53°F). However, prepare for quite a bit of rain, as precipitation amounts reach 162 mm (6.4 in) over approximately 16 days. With humidity levels at a staggering 83%, May in Changsha presents a vibrant tapestry of warmth and moisture, inviting both exploration and the occasional rain shower.

May and January present stark contrasts in weather conditions. In May, temperatures soar with a minimum of 12°C (53°F) and an average of 22°C (71°F), reaching highs of up to 35°C (96°F). This month experiences considerable rainfall, with an average of 162 mm (6.4 in) across 16 days and a high humidity level of 83%. In contrast, January is much cooler, featuring a minimum temperature of -3°C (27°F) and an average of 7°C (45°F), with a maximum of just 15°C (60°F). Precipitation in January is significantly lower at 42 mm (1.7 in) over 8 days, coupled with a humidity of 72%. May and June both exhibit warm temperatures, with June generally being slightly hotter. In May, temperatures range from a minimum of 12°C (53°F) to a maximum of 35°C (96°F), averaging around 22°C (71°F). In contrast, June sees a higher minimum of 15°C (59°F) and an average temperature of 25°C (77°F), peaking at 36°C (97°F). Precipitation increases in June to 214 mm (8.4 in), compared to May's 162 mm (6.4 in), and the number of rainy days also rises slightly from 16 in May to 17 in June. Humidity levels remain quite similar, with May at 83% and June at 84%. For more details on June weather, check out Changsha weather in June.
